#478455 Hex color

#478455

The hexadecimal color code #478455 corresponds to the code RGB( 71, 132, 85 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,28 level), green (at 0,52 level) and blue (at 0,33 level). Its brightness is 39% and its saturation is 30%. It is composed of red at 24%, green at 45% and blue at 29%.
